摘要
随着武器装备的体系化和复杂化,装备维修保障要求提高,但现有的维修工时数计算方法存在很多不足。为此根据维修人员工时需求产生过程,运用以可靠性为中心的维修理论(RCM)中的预防性维修策略和方法,建立基于工龄更换的工时计算模型。计算机仿真结果表明,与传统维修工时计算方法相比,考虑预防性维修的计算方法使维修效率提高了36.53%,并且对确定维修人员数量、优化维修人员配置和提高维修效率有重要的作用。
        With complicated weapon equipment system, the requirements for equipment maintenance and support are higher, but the existing maintenance man-hour calculation methods have many shortcomings. A man-hour calculation model based on service age replacement was constructed based on the preventive maintenance strategy in Reliability-Centered Maintenance(RCM) theory. The computer simulation results show that the proposed method improves the maintenance efficiency by 36.53% compared to the traditional maintenance man-hour calculation method, and can play an important role in determining the number of maintenance personnel, optimizing the maintenance personnel assignment using maintenance resources efficiently and improving maintenance efficiency.
